God of War Ragnarok: What Is It?

God of War Ragnarok is an action adventure game with RPG elements, primarily developed by Santa Monica Studio. It's a direct sequel to 2018's God of War, the PS4 game that revamped the franchise with its Norse mythology setting among other huge changes. Following the exploits of Kratos, a god with a violent past, and his son Atreus, players will venture out into an icy, unforgiving landscape and engage in brutal combat, defeat larger-than-life bosses, solve environmental puzzles, and more.

God of War Ragnarok: What Are the Differences Between the PS5 and PS4 Versions?

God of War Ragnarok will be exactly the same core game on both PS5 and PS4. You'll get to experience everything in terms of the story, combat encounters, and exploration regardless of which console you use to play it. That being said, the PS5 version will have some advantages over the PS4 version, owing to its increased power and unique features. These benefits are likely to include:

  • Reduced loading times
  • Enhanced visual fidelity
  • Multiple video options, allowing you to choose between a higher frame rate or increased resolution
  • Haptic feedback and adaptive trigger support on the DualSense controller
  • 3D audio
  • Activity Cards and Game Help

God of War Ragnarok: Is There a Free Upgrade from PS4 to PS5?

No. If you buy God of War Ragnarok on PS4 and wish to upgrade to the PS5 version at a later date, it will cost you $10/£10. Alternatively, you can buy the Digital Deluxe edition or one of the non-standard physical editions to gain access to both versions.

God of War Ragnarok: What Is the Story?

God of War Ragnarok's story follows the events of the previous game. Ragnarok, the world-ending battle prophesied by the Norse gods, is on its way, and Kratos and Atreus must prepare by visiting each of the nine realms. With Atreus looking to figure out who he is and the Asgardian gods watching, the father and son duo make new allies and even more enemies as they try to prevent Ragnarok. However, tensions are running high; Kratos has spent years recovering from his blood-soaked past, while Atreus argues fighting is inevitable.

God of War Ragnarok: What Is Ragnarok?

In Norse mythology, Ragnarok is the name given to a battle so fierce that it destroys the world. The gods of Asgard go to war against the giants of Jotunheim. Prophecies say it is inevitable, and will result in the death of many key figures as well as cataclysmic natural disasters. It's a big deal, in other words, and in this game, Kratos and Atreus are attempting to stop it from happening.

God of War Ragnarok: Which Gods and Characters Will You Meet?

God of War Ragnarok is set within the world of Norse mythology, as established in the last game. In God of War 2018, we meet several gods and other notable characters, including:

  • Freya — former wife of Odin, goddess of love and fertility, mother of Baldur
  • Baldur — son of Odin and Freya, god of light, cannot feel pain
  • Magni and Modi — sons of Thor
  • Brok and Sindri — brothers, legendary dwarven blacksmiths
  • Mimir — former advisor to Odin, "smartest man alive"
  • Jörmungandr — the World Serpent, a giant snake living in the Lake of Nine

Making their debut in Ragnarok, the following characters will join the fray:

  • Tyr — son of Odin, the Norse god of war and justice
  • Thor — son of Odin, god of thunder
  • Odin — the Allfather, ruler of the Norse gods
  • Angrboda — giant, wife of Loki, mother of Jörmungandr, Fenrir, and Hel
  • Durlin — dwarf
  • Fenrir — giant wolf god, son of Angrboda

God of War Ragnarok: What New Gameplay Features Are There?

While God of War Ragnarok will play very similarly to the previous game, there will be one or two new things to enjoy. The first notable thing that springs to mind is riding a wolf-pulled sled to get around the frozen Lake of Nine. Additionally, there are some tweaks to combat and traversal. You'll be able to equip different shields with unique properties to increase Kratos' defensive options, while special elemental moves will be added to his repertoire.

God of War Ragnarok: Is the Game Shot in One Single Take?

God of War (2018) was rather unique in that the entire game was presented in a single, flowing camera shot that would weave around the action but never contain a hard cut. It has been confirmed that God of War Ragnarok will follow this direction, with one unbroken shot following the action through the whole game.
